Applications of Booster Compressor

PET Bottle Manufacturing

High pressure air is essential for PET bottle blowing processes. Booster compressors provide the required pressure amplification for efficient production.

Hydrogen Energy Industry

Booster compressors play an important role in hydrogen compression and filling systems where higher pressure levels are required.

Nitrogen & Oxygen Systems

Integrated with PSA nitrogen generators and oxygen generators, booster compressors increase gas pressure for storage, transportation and industrial usage.

Industrial Manufacturing

Used in pressure testing, automation equipment, and various production processes requiring high pressure air supply.

Booster Compressor FAQ

1. What is a Booster Compressor and how does it work?

A Booster Compressor is a high pressure compression system designed to increase the pressure of already compressed air or industrial gases.

Unlike a standard air compressor that compresses atmospheric air, a Booster Compressor receives pre-compressed gas and further increases the pressure to meet specific industrial requirements. GESO Booster Compressors use reliable piston compression technology to achieve stable high pressure output for various applications.

2. What is the difference between a Booster Compressor and a standard air compressor?

A standard air compressor generates compressed air from atmospheric pressure, while a Booster Compressor increases the pressure of existing compressed air or gas.

Booster Compressors are typically used when the required discharge pressure exceeds the capability of conventional compressors, such as PET blowing, gas filling, hydrogen systems and industrial testing applications.

4. Can a Booster Compressor be used for nitrogen boosting?

Yes. A Nitrogen Booster Compressor is commonly integrated with PSA nitrogen generators to increase nitrogen pressure for storage, transportation or industrial processes.

By combining a nitrogen generator with a booster system, customers can produce nitrogen on-site and achieve higher pressure output without relying on external gas cylinders.

5. Can a Booster Compressor compress oxygen or other industrial gases?

Yes, Booster Compressors can be designed for different industrial gases according to application requirements.

For oxygen, hydrogen or special gases, the compressor configuration, sealing materials, lubrication system and safety design need to be selected according to the gas characteristics.
